Kerang is a village of 300 people in 54 households (Census 2011) in Tingkhong block, Dibrugarh district, Assam, the 174th-largest of 223 villages in Tingkhong block. Literacy is 77%, 16 points above the block average of 62% and the sex ratio is 1,055 women per 1,000 men. The pincode is 786611, served by Rajgarh (Dibrugarh) post office; the LGD village code is 292157. The sarpanch is Pushpa Rajkonwar. The population is estimated at 354 in 2026, up 18% since the 2011 Census.
